Summary
The Business Analyst, IT Product Management is a role within the Information Technology department and will be responsible for providing support throughout the entire software & solution product lifecycle. This includes product solution scoping through requirements gathering to development to rollout and ongoing product solution optimization. This role ensures that all product solutions align with the company’s strategic goals, meet market needs, and deliver value to our dealer customers, agents, and field sales teams. The Business Analyst, IT Product Management works closely with cross-functional teams, including the leadership, sales, marketing, claims, operations, accounting, IT product managers, IT engineering, and the enterprise program office to ensure execution excellence.
The ideal candidate will bridge the gap between stakeholders and the technical team, ensuring that business requirements are clearly defined and effectively communicated. The Business Analyst, IT Product Management will play a crucial role in analyzing business needs, documenting requirements, and facilitating the development of software product solutions that meet organizational goals.
Essential Duties and Responsibilities
- Work collaboratively with stakeholders to gather and analyze business requirements.
- Document functional and non-functional requirements for software development projects.
- Create detailed use cases, user stories, and process flow diagrams.
- Work closely with developers, product managers, and project managers to ensure requirements are understood and implemented correctly.
- Conduct gap analysis and feasibility studies to identify potential solutions.
- Facilitate workshops and meetings to elicit requirements and gather feedback.
- Assist in the development of test plans and participate in user acceptance testing (UAT).
- Monitor project progress and provide updates to stakeholders to include:
- Status reporting to ensure standards, consistency, and efficiency of project execution.
- Updating capacity needs against estimates.
- Early escalation of red flags that put the software product development off timeline.
- Ensure proper attention is given to project risks.
- Collaborate with development teams and stakeholders to identify contingency and risk mitigation opportunities.
- Identify opportunities for process improvements, improved development governance, and contribute to the continuous enhancement of the software development lifecycle.
Education and Experience
- Bachelor’s degree in Business Administration, Computer Science, or a related field.
- Proven experience and expertise as a Business Analyst in software development projects.
- Strong understanding of software development methodologies (e.g., Agile, Scrum, Waterfall).
- Proficiency in requirements gathering techniques and documentation practices.
- Excellent analytical and problem-solving skills.
- Demonstrated skill in working with a matrixed team focused on large complex initiatives.
- Strong communication and interpersonal skills, with the ability to work collaboratively in a team environment.
- Familiarity with project management tools (e.g., JIRA, Trello) and software development tools (e.g., UML, BPMN).
- Knowledge of database management and basic SQL is a plus.
- CBAP and/or CCBA certification preferred.
- Automotive F&I experience strongly preferred.
